Objective: Unusual clinical course Background: Cardiac tamponade is a life-threatening condition that occurs when pericardial fluid accumulates in the pericardial sac, causing compression of the heart and obstructive shock. This hemodynamic event typically occurs in right-sided cardiac chambers due to the low pressures of the right atrium and right ventricle. Patients undergoing left ventricular assist device (LVAD) placement are at particularly high risk of pericardial effusion development and potential cardiac tamponade because of the need for postoperative anticoagulation. Case Report: A 47-year-old man underwent LVAD placement for deteriorating biventricular function. After several days of stability postoperatively, he experienced dyspnea and had evidence of increasing hemodynamic compromise. He was immediately taken to the operating room, where transesophageal echocardiography showed near-complete collapse of the left atrium and left ventricle with preservation of the right heart chamber sizes in the setting of a large heterogenous posterior pericardial effusion. With swift surgical intervention, the cardiac tamponade was successfully evacuated and the patient regained hemodynamic stability. Conclusions: Cardiac tamponade can present overtly or covertly, and should be high on the list of differential diagnoses in a patient with deterioration in hemodynamic status after cardiac surgery, especially after LVAD placement. Although cardiac tamponade usually affects right-sided cardiac chambers, the left-sided chambers can also be involved. Isolated left-sided cardiac tamponade is rare but can occur in the presence of a loculated posterior pericardial effusion, as seen in this patient.
